Erratum to: Antibiotic use varies substantially among adults: a cross-national study from five European Countries in the ARITMO project

Appendix Table 5 in the original version of this article unfortunately contained a mistake. The overall age- and sex standardized annual prevalence of antibiotic use as shown in Table 5 was inadvertently based on partial data. We would like to correct the erroneous numbers. All changes are reflected in the revised table presented here.

Annual prevalence is expressed per 1000 person-years and is calculated by adding the number of individuals exposed to the antibiotic compound for at least 1 day divided by the total persons in the study and divided by the number of years of observation
AUH Aarhus University Hospital, ERD Emilia-Romagnia regional database, GePaRD German Pharmacoepidemiological Research Database, THIN the health initiative network
